Output 153f509a7cb2c9fad162ce806a760346c730b81830c125dd096ecb61b7784f70:3

value
42392803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ae29c8b9afbe70573fee7994f11e0f046d8943a OP_EQUAL
address
MDGWtoLfnjZjSnWemAGHQDNeQoxVgJ4v6v
transaction
153f509a7cb2c9fad162ce806a760346c730b81830c125dd096ecb61b7784f70
spent
true